A New EP300‐Related Syndrome With Prominent Developmental and Immune Phenotypes

open access: yesAmerican Journal of Medical Genetics Part A, EarlyView.
ABSTRACT Rubinstein Taybi syndrome (RTS) is a disorder of chromatin remodeling and transcriptional regulation caused by heterozygous pathogenic variants in CREBBP and EP300. RTS is characterized by a distinct facial gestalt, intellectual disability, structural kidney and heart differences, feeding difficulties, and broad thumbs and great toes ...
